Snowflake Cortex

Snowflake Cortex is a strong AI layer for teams whose data lives in Snowflake. Cortex Analyst turns natural language into governed SQL over a semantic model you author in Snowflake, and it honors Snowflake’s access controls natively. CoWork adds an agentic experience with Deep Research reports. That intelligence is real, and it runs where your Snowflake data lives, on a model you build and maintain there.

Only once the data lands in Snowflake. Cortex's analytics run within your Snowflake account, and Snowflake can widen what that account sees. Catalog-linked databases sync external Iceberg catalogs, including Databricks Unity Catalog. Openflow ships CDC connectors that copy Postgres, MySQL, SQL Server, Oracle, MongoDB, and BigQuery data into Snowflake. But every route runs through Snowflake, so the data has to land there before Cortex can reason over it. Orion is built the other way around. It connects read-only across the warehouses and sources you already run. It can investigate a question that spans Snowflake, BigQuery, and Databricks together in a single analysis. If your reality is more than one warehouse, that difference decides whether you get the whole picture or one vendor's slice of it.

Mostly you have to ask. Cortex Analyst is request-response. Snowflake also ships an anomaly-detection ML function. But it is a separate SQL feature you build and operate yourself, not wired into Cortex Analyst chat. CoWork's subscription-driven briefs and anomaly alerts are the closer analogue, plus an Automations feature Snowflake labels public preview soon.
